The Quillstone rendering pipeline converts untrusted markdown to sanitized HTML in three stages: parsing, AST filtering, and attribute whitelisting. Raw input never reaches the template layer, and embedded HTML is stripped before rendering. Sanitization rules are versioned and auditable through the Fernwick policy endpoint. To query the policy audit log, authenticate with the internal key shown below.

gateway credential: kto3_qfe

When the Lanternmap prefetcher stalls, first confirm the worker pool is draining rather than crashed: check the queue depth gauge and the last-heartbeat timestamp for each region shard. If heartbeats are older than five minutes, restart the prefetcher with the `--resume-cursor` flag so it picks up from the last committed tile batch rather than re-fetching the whole extent. Before restarting, verify the cursor table is reachable and not mid-vacuum by connecting to the prefetcher's state database with the connection string below.

primary connection of yagep-kahip = redis://giliel_svc:zYiKsLL2PLpfPL@db-348f.xolmarsys.corp:5432/fenwyn

Subject: Sproutly cut-over — all done, mostly

Hey,

Quick recap: we moved the plant-watering scheduler off the old cron box onto the new Sproutly worker fleet this morning. Schedules migrated cleanly, and the greenhouse zones all fired their first cycles on time. One hiccup — zone staggering was briefly doubled, so a few beds got an extra soak. Harmless, but watch moisture alerts tonight. If anything pages you, the knobs you'll care about are below; these are the values now running in production:

service settings:
PRAIX_LOG_LEVEL=error
PRAIX_METRICS_HOST=metrics.praix.qorvelcorp.corp
PRAIX_POOL_SIZE=16